What are entry level history jobs?

Entry level history jobs are positions suitable for recent graduates or individuals with limited professional experience in the field of history. These roles may include research assistants, museum aides, archives technicians, historical interpreters, or educational coordinators. They typically require a bachelor’s degree in history or a related field, and offer opportunities to gain practical experience while working in museums, archives, educational institutions, or government agencies. These positions often serve as stepping stones to more advanced roles in research, education, or historical preservation.

What types of projects or tasks can an entry-level history professional expect to work on in their first year?

As an entry-level history professional, you can expect to assist with research projects, archival organization, and the preparation of educational materials or exhibits. Many roles involve supporting senior historians by gathering primary and secondary sources, cataloging artifacts or documents, and helping with data entry or analysis. You may also collaborate with educators, curators, or researchers on public outreach or historical preservation efforts. These experiences help build foundational skills and provide exposure to various career paths within the field.

What is the difference between Entry Level History vs Entry Level Social Studies Teacher?

AspectEntry Level HistoryEntry Level Social Studies Teacher
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in History or related fieldBachelor's degree in Education or Social Studies, state certification
Work EnvironmentResearch, museums, archives, officesPublic or private schools, classrooms
Industry UsageAcademic, research, cultural institutionsEducation, K-12 teaching
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ding historical careers, entry requirementsTeaching roles, certification process

Entry Level History roles focus on research, analysis, and cultural institutions, requiring a history degree. Entry Level Social Studies Teacher positions involve teaching K-12 students, requiring education credentials and certification. While both roles involve history content, one is research-oriented, and the other is education-focused.
